Five Talents Usa
Five Talents Usa reported paying Elizabeth Ha, Ceo, $109,482 in total compensation (FY 2023).
That places Elizabeth Ha at approximately the 34th percentile among 29 similarly sized international affairs nonprofits (median $131,655).
